What is Paint Protection Film (PPF)?
PPF is a thin, transparent layer applied over your car’s paint.
- Protects against scratches, stone chips and minor dents
- Often comes with a PPF coating that helps resist stains and scratches
- Can have self-healing properties, repairing minor scratches automatically
PPF acts like armor for your car, but just like any protective layer, it needs care to remain effective.
Why Maintenance is Important
Maintaining your PPF is crucial because:
- Extends lifespan: Proper care can make PPF last 5–10 years.
- Maintains appearance: Regular cleaning keeps your car glossy and new-looking.
- Preserves protection: Dirt, grime and chemicals can degrade the film over time.
- Prevents expensive repairs: Replacing PPF prematurely can cost a lot.
Daily Care for Your PPF
Even simple habits help keep your PPF in good condition:
- Avoid parking under trees where sap or bird droppings can fall
- Cover your car during long periods of sun exposure
- Wipe off dust and dirt gently using a soft microfiber cloth
- Inspect the edges and corners regularly for lifting
Washing Tips for PPF
- Use mild soap and water: Harsh detergents can damage the coating.
- Soft cloths or sponges: Avoid abrasive scrubbers that can scratch the film.
- Two-bucket method: One bucket for clean water, one for soap to reduce dirt transfer.
- Rinse thoroughly: Make sure no soap residue remains on the film.
Avoiding Damage from Chemicals and Tools
- Avoid strong chemicals like engine degreasers or industrial cleaners
- Never use abrasive brushes, steel wool or rough scrub pads
- Avoid pressure washers directly on the edges, as high pressure can lift the film
Do’s and Don’ts of Waxing and Polishing
- Some PPFs are compatible with wax and polish; check the manufacturer’s instructions
- Do: Use waxes labelled safe for PPF
- Don’t: Polish aggressively or use compounds that can remove the coating
- For self-healing PPF, light heat exposure or sunlight often helps scratches heal without polishing
Self-Healing PPF – How to Care for It
- Minor scratches disappear naturally with heat or sunlight
- Avoid abrasive cleaning that can damage the top layer
- For stubborn scratches, a warm microfiber cloth can help accelerate the healing process
- Regular washing is still important to prevent dirt from embedding into scratches
Protecting PPF in Extreme Weather
- Hot climates: Use shade or car covers to prevent UV damage
- Cold climates: Avoid ice scrapers on PPF; use soft brushes for snow removal
- Rainy seasons: Rinse dirt and debris promptly to prevent water spots and contaminants
Professional Maintenance and Inspections
- Schedule professional inspections once a year to check for peeling, discolouration or damage
- Professionals can apply a fresh topcoat or repair edges for a longer lifespan
- Professional detailing helps maintain the PPF coating without reducing its effectiveness
Common Mistakes That Reduce PPF Lifespan
- Using harsh chemicals for cleaning
- High-pressure washers on edges or corners
- Aggressive polishing or abrasive pads
- Ignoring minor lifting or damage early
- Not washing regularly, allowing dirt and grime to accumulate
